2. "Adapting to Change: Innovations in Productivity Management Techniques for Today's Workplace"

In today's rapidly evolving business landscape, organizations are constantly challenged to adapt to change in order to remain competitive and maintain productivity. One standout example of innovation in productivity management techniques comes from Amazon, with its implementation of the "Two-Pizza Team" concept. Instead of large teams which can lead to inefficiency and decreased productivity, Amazon introduced small teams that could be fed with just two pizzas, encouraging autonomy, accountability, and faster decision-making. This approach has proven successful, leading to improved efficiency and innovation within the company.

Another compelling case is that of Zappos, an online shoe and clothing retailer known for its unique approach to organizational culture. Zappos implemented the Holacracy framework, a self-management practice that eliminates traditional managerial hierarchy and fosters a more decentralized decision-making process. This innovative approach has resulted in increased employee engagement, creativity, and adaptability to change, ultimately boosting productivity and performance within the company. For readers facing similar challenges in adapting to change in the workplace, it is essential to consider adopting agile methodologies like Scrum or Kanban. These methods prioritize flexibility, collaboration, and continuous improvement, aligning perfectly with the need for innovation and productivity in today's fast-paced environment. By embracing a culture of experimentation, learning, and adaptation, organizations can thrive amidst change and uncertainty.

4. "From Apps to Automation: Exploring New Tools for Enhancing Productivity"

In today's digital era, businesses are constantly seeking innovative ways to boost productivity and streamline operations. One company that has successfully leveraged automation tools to enhance productivity is Slack. By integrating various apps and bots within its platform, Slack has revolutionized communication and collaboration within teams. For example, they offer integrations with project management tools like Trello and Asana, allowing users to seamlessly perform tasks within a single interface. This has not only increased efficiency but also reduced the need for constant context-switching, ultimately leading to higher productivity levels.

Another organization at the forefront of utilizing automation for productivity gains is Salesforce. Through their extensive ecosystem of automation tools, such as Salesforce Einstein AI and Marketing Cloud automation, they have enabled businesses to automate repetitive tasks, personalize customer interactions, and make data-driven decisions. By embracing these tools, Salesforce has helped organizations improve their efficiency, drive sales, and deliver exceptional customer experiences. For instance, implementing automated lead scoring has enabled companies to prioritize and nurture leads effectively, resulting in higher conversion rates and revenue growth.

For readers looking to explore new tools for enhancing productivity, it is essential to start by assessing their specific needs and pain points. Conducting a thorough analysis of current workflows and identifying areas that can benefit from automation is crucial. Additionally, investing time in employee training and change management processes can ensure a smooth transition to new tools. It is also advisable to explore methodologies like Agile and Lean principles, which emphasize continuous improvement and efficiency. By embracing a culture of innovation and being open to adopting new technologies, businesses can stay ahead of the competition and drive sustainable growth in today's fast-paced business environment.

6. "The Rise of Remote Work: How Organizations are Embracing Virtual Productivity Solutions"

The rise of remote work has been a transformative trend in the world of business, with organizations across various industries embracing virtual productivity solutions at an increasing rate. One notable example is Buffer, a social media management company that has been a pioneer in remote work practices. With a fully distributed team of employees spread across different locations, Buffer has successfully built a strong culture of accountability, communication, and collaboration, thanks to the use of tools like Slack, Zoom, and Trello. By prioritizing results over hours worked, Buffer has demonstrated that virtual productivity can lead to high levels of employee engagement and satisfaction.

Another case study that exemplifies the benefits of remote work is Zapier, a workflow automation company that operates with a 100% remote workforce. By implementing a results-oriented work environment and leveraging tools such as Asana and GitHub, Zapier has achieved impressive results, including a 95% employee retention rate and consistent revenue growth. The company's commitment to providing flexibility and trust to its employees has not only improved productivity but also enhanced work-life balance and job satisfaction. For readers navigating the challenges of remote work, it is crucial to prioritize clear communication, establish regular check-ins with team members, and leverage project management tools effectively. Adopting methodologies like Agile or Scrum can also help teams stay organized, focused, and adaptable in a virtual work setting, promoting efficiency and collaboration. In a world where remote work is becoming the new normal, embracing virtual productivity solutions with the right mindset, tools, and practices can lead to successful outcomes for both individuals and organizations.

7. "Data-Driven Decisions: Leveraging Analytics for Improved Productivity in the Digital Era"

In the age of digital transformation, data-driven decisions have become a crucial component for organizations looking to enhance productivity and stay competitive. One compelling example comes from Netflix, a global streaming service that has revolutionized the entertainment industry through the proficient use of analytics. By analyzing viewers' behaviors and preferences, Netflix leverages data to personalize recommendations, optimize content creation, and make strategic decisions. This approach has significantly contributed to their success, with statistics showing that 80% of content watched on Netflix is based on these data-informed recommendations.

Similarly, Amazon, the e-commerce giant, is a prime example of the power of data analytics in driving productivity. Through their sophisticated algorithms, Amazon analyzes customer data to predict purchasing patterns, optimize inventory management, and customize the user experience. This data-driven strategy has propelled Amazon to become one of the most dominant players in the retail industry, with studies indicating that personalized recommendations account for 35% of their revenue. For readers looking to leverage analytics for improved productivity, it is essential to invest in robust data collection tools, establish clear goals for data analysis, and consistently monitor and adjust strategies based on insights gained. Additionally, adopting methodologies such as the Agile approach can help organizations adapt quickly to data-driven insights and implement changes effectively in the digital era.
